2D-PAGE -- Proteome database system for microbial and other model organisms research

What you can do:
Retrieve descriptive information about the bacterial and other model organisms' proteins identified on 2-D PAGE maps.
Highlights:
  • A proteome database system (http://www.mpiib-berlin.mpg.de/2D-PAGE) for microbial research has been constructed which integrates 2-DE/MS, ICAT-LC/MS and functional classification data of proteins with genomic, metabolic and other biological knowledge sources.
  • The two-dimensional polyacrylamide gel electrophoresis database delivers experimental data on microbial proteins including mass spectra for the validation of protein identification.
  • As of 2006, the database system includes proteome information for the following organisms:
  • Bacillus anthracis
  • Bartonella henselae
  • Borrelia garinii
  • Chlamydia pneumoniae
  • Chlamydophila pneumoniae
  • Francisella tularensis
  • Helicobacter pylori
  • Homo sapiens (human)
  • Mus musculus (mouse)
  • Mycobacterium bovis (Mycobacteria)
  • Mycobacterium tuberculosis
  • Mycoplasma pneumoniae
  • Paracoccus denitrificans
  • Rattus norvegicus (rat)
  • Vibrio cholerae
